I used Stampin Up's "Pleasant Poppies" backgrounder stamp. Stamped with memento black ink onto water colour paper. Coloured with Tombow and Stampin Up markers. Dotted centers with white gel pen. I Spritzed the image panel with Perfect Pearls Mist "Interference red"
Matted with black and rose red cardstock. Sewed edges. Stamped birthday sentiment on vellum with memento black and clear embossed. Tore vellum. Attached to Image panel. Punched out the butterflies and glued on. Added the silver half pearls.
